Understanding the Risks
When considering the safety of using treated wood indoors, it’s crucial to understand the potential risks involved. While treated wood offers benefits like durability and resistance to decay, there are essential factors to keep in mind to make an informed decision for your indoor spaces.
Evaluating Chemical Exposure
In indoor settings, treated wood can release chemicals such as arsenic or creosote into the air. The prolonged exposure to these substances can pose health risks to you and your family. It’s important to assess the level of chemical emissions from treated wood products to minimize any potential health hazards.
Impact on Indoor Air Quality
The use of treated wood indoors can affect the overall air quality of your living environment. Chemical emissions from treated wood can contribute to poor indoor air quality, leading to respiratory issues or other health concerns. Proper ventilation and monitoring of indoor air quality are crucial when incorporating treated wood into your indoor projects.
Children and Pets Safety
If you have children or pets in your household, extra caution is necessary when using treated wood indoors. Young children and pets are more susceptible to the effects of chemicals leaching from treated wood. Ensure proper sealing or encapsulation of treated wood to prevent direct contact and minimize risks to your loved ones.

Evaluating Alternatives
When considering alternatives to treated wood for indoor use, there are several options that can provide a safer environment for you and your household. Here are some alternatives you can explore:
Untreated Hardwoods
Opting for untreated hardwoods such as oak, maple, or cherry can be a great alternative to treated wood. These hardwoods are durable and can be sealed with natural finishes to protect them from moisture and wear. They provide a natural and safer option for your indoor projects.
Engineered Wood Products
Engineered wood products like plywood, MDF (Medium Density Fiberboard), or particle board are manufactured by binding together wood fibers, strands, or veneers. These products are designed to be strong, stable, and free from the harmful chemicals present in treated wood. They are versatile and available in various finishes to suit your indoor needs.
Recycled Plastic Lumber
Recycled plastic lumber is a sustainable alternative to traditional wood. Made from recycled plastic materials, this type of lumber is durable, resistant to moisture, and does not require sealants. It’s an eco-friendly option that can be used indoors for various construction and design projects.
Metal Products
Metal products such as aluminum, steel, or iron can be excellent alternatives to wood for certain indoor applications. They offer durability, strength, and a modern aesthetic. Metal products can be used in furniture, shelving, or structural elements, providing a stylish and safe option for your indoor space.
Bamboo
Bamboo is a renewable and eco-friendly alternative to traditional wood. It’s lightweight, strong, and offers a unique look for indoor projects. Bamboo can be used for flooring, furniture, and decorative elements, providing a sustainable choice that doesn’t compromise on style or functionality.

Maintenance and Precautions
When using treated wood indoors, it’s essential to follow proper maintenance and take necessary precautions to ensure the safety of your household members. Here are some practical tips to help you maintain treated wood and minimize potential risks:
Regular Inspection and Cleaning
Inspect treated wood regularly for any signs of damage, such as cracks, splinters, or discoloration. Promptly address any issues to prevent further deterioration. Regular cleaning with mild soap and water can help remove dust and dirt buildup, maintaining the wood’s appearance and longevity.
Sealants and Coatings
Consider using appropriate sealants or coatings to protect treated wood from exposure to moisture, UV rays, and other environmental factors. Sealants can help reduce the leaching of chemicals from the wood and provide an extra layer of protection, enhancing its durability over time.
Monitoring Indoor Air Quality
Keep an eye on indoor air quality when using treated wood indoors. Proper ventilation is crucial to reduce the concentration of chemicals that may be released from the wood. Ensure rooms are well-ventilated, especially during and after construction or renovation projects involving treated wood.
Preventative Measures
Take preventative measures to avoid direct skin contact with treated wood. Use gloves when handling the wood, especially during cutting or sanding processes. Wash hands thoroughly after working with treated wood to minimize exposure to any residual chemicals.
Replacement Considerations
If treated wood shows significant signs of wear or damage that cannot be effectively repaired, consider replacing the affected pieces with safer alternatives, such as untreated hardwoods, engineered wood products, or recycled materials.
